Legal Standing and Licensing in Different Territories
Online gambling regulation differs dramatically across global territories, forming a intricate legal landscape. Some jurisdictions sustain full prohibitions on internet-based wagering, while others have developed extensive licensing frameworks. European nations like Malta, Gibraltar, and the Isle of Man have created robust oversight systems that draw worldwide providers seeking reputable licenses.
Licensing authorities impose stringent standards on candidates before awarding operational permits. Authorities review monetary soundness, technical framework, accountable gambling guidelines, and anti-money laundering processes. Certified operators must pay considerable costs, undergo to routine audits, and preserve minimum capital holdings to safeguard player funds. The United Kingdom Gambling Commission and Malta Gaming Authority embody two of the most respected regulatory organizations.
Jurisdictional differences generate challenges for providers aiming at international users. Some jurisdictions require domestic licensing for sector access, while others accept international licenses. Operators must manage different tax systems, marketing constraints, and compliance obligations. Safety and Information Safety in Online Casinos
Casino systems implement various safety tiers to safeguard sensitive player information and monetary transactions. Encryption systems establishes the foundation of data protection, with operators utilizing SSL credentials to secure exchanges between player gadgets and platform systems. This encryption stops unpermitted entities from capturing individual details, payment authentication, or account information during transmission.
Authentication platforms verify player profiles and prevent unauthorized account entry. Platforms demand secure credentials, utilize two-factor verification, and observe login trends for suspicious behavior. Know Your Customer protocols require identity verification through file upload, ensuring players satisfy age criteria and conform with anti-money laundering requirements. Payment safety gets special consideration given the monetary character of casino activities. Operators collaborate with approved payment providers who preserve PCI DSS compliance requirements. Many systems employ tokenization systems that exchange confidential information with secure references. Periodic protection audits executed by autonomous firms reveal vulnerabilities and ensure defensive steps meet field requirements.
Game Catalogs: From Classic Slots to Modern Game Shows
Current casino sites present extensive game libraries featuring thousands of games across multiple categories. Slot machines dominate most catalogs, spanning from conventional three-reel designs to complex video slots with numerous paylines, extra characteristics, and cumulative jackpots. Software developers launch new slot games frequently, including different themes from ancient civilizations to popular culture nods.
Table games constitute another critical type, with electronic versions of bl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ker accessible in many formats. Many sites provide both standard virtual versions and live dealer alternatives where actual croupiers run games via video streaming technology, creating an absorbing experience that bridges virtual and real-world gambling settings.
Recent years have seen the emergence of game show-style products that blend amusement elements with gambling mechanics. Games like Crazy Time and Monopoly Live showcase vibrant presenters, rotating wheels, and bonus sessions resembling television programs. These developments appeal to players seeking engaging experiences beyond traditional casino offerings. VIP Schemes, Reward Schemes and User Retention
Casino operators implement reward programs to promote sustained activity and compensate consistent members. These systems usually offer tiered arrangements where users gather credits through wagering activity and progress through bronze, silver, gold, and platinum stages. Each level unlocks additional benefits such as quicker cashout processing, assigned account handlers, private bonuses, and invitations to special events.
VIP initiatives focus on high-value players who generate considerable earnings through regular contributions and prolonged play periods. Providers assign personal account representatives to VIP users, offering customized service and resolving issues promptly. Premium players receive customized promotions, increased deposit limits, and entry to restricted events with considerable reward pools. Marketing Tactics: Partners, Rewards and Campaigns
Affiliate promotion constitutes a main customer obtainment avenue for online casinos. Providers work with site proprietors, material creators, and advertising experts who promote casino brands to their audiences. Partners earn commissions grounded on recommended players, typically through earnings distribution models or cost-per-acquisition agreements. Welcome bonuses act as strong inducements for new player registration and initial payments. Typical offers feature deposit matches where providers award bonus credits comparable to a portion of the first deposit, or complimentary spin bundles for slot games. Providers structure bonus conditions with wagering criteria that equilibrate player benefit against operational sustainability.
Continuous advertising initiatives sustain player activity past first sign-up. Reload incentives recognize current players placing extra payments, while cashback promotions refund percentages of deficits during specified timeframes. Holiday campaigns connected to holidays or athletic events create anticipation and stimulate increased engagement. Threats and Issues: Addiction, Deception and Oversight
Pathological gambling comprises a significant social issue linked with online casino functions. The accessibility and ease of web-based platforms can intensify compulsive behaviors, with some users developing destructive associations with gambling activities. Responsible operators implement self-exclusion features, deposit limits, and awareness notifications that notify users to period used playing. Many sites partner with groups focusing in gambling addiction help to provide resources and therapy referrals.
Fraudulent practices pose persistent obstacles for operators and users both. Payment scams, reward misuse, and account takeovers necessitate perpetual monitoring and advanced identification systems. Operators implement machine learning models to identify suspicious trends such as numerous accounts generated from matching IP addresses or unusual betting actions.
